Pakistan Supports Saudi Arabia’s Bid to Host FIFA World Cup 2034

Pakistan’s declaration of support for Saudi Arabia’s bid to host the 2034 FIFA World Cup is a significant diplomatic gesture with potential ramifications for both nations. The Foreign Office’s statement, affirming Pakistan’s endorsement of Saudi Arabia’s aspirations, underscores the strong ties between the two countries and their shared enthusiasm for promoting international sports and cultural events.

By backing Saudi Arabia’s bid, Pakistan not only strengthens its bilateral relations but also aligns itself with a nation aiming to enhance its global image through sports diplomacy. Hosting the FIFA World Cup is a prestigious opportunity to showcase a country’s capabilities, infrastructure, and hospitality on the world stage.

Mumtaz Zahra Baloch’s expression of confidence in Saudi Arabia’s ability to make the World Cup an unforgettable event reflects the optimism and goodwill between the two nations. If Saudi Arabia secures the hosting rights, it could foster closer ties between the Middle East and South Asia, facilitating cultural exchanges and economic cooperation.

Additionally, Pakistan’s support may help Saudi Arabia garner more votes and international backing in its bid against potential competitors. The FIFA World Cup is a global event, and the endorsement of friendly nations can carry significant weight in the decision-making process. Ultimately, this move not only reinforces Pakistan’s diplomatic ties but also contributes to the broader goal of promoting international unity and cooperation through sports.
